On this episode of Interviews with Anthony Beyrouti, we had the privilege of sitting down with our very own, Simon Dykstra. For those of you that don't know, Simon is both a parent and a coach in our VK Program, having coached his younger daughter Louise in 2019 and his older daughter Marah in 2020.  

As a teacher and coach in the Vancouver School District for over 20 years, Simon continues to give back by sharing his knowledge and love of the game with hundreds of  young student-athletes.  

Prior to becoming a teacher, Simon had a very successful playing career at SFU from 1986-1990 under Head Coaches, Stan Stewardson (1986-1989) and Jay Triano (1989-1990); who would go on to become the Head Coach of the Toronto Raptors from 2008-2011.  

Following his successful career at Simon Fraser, Simon went on to play professionally overseas in Copenhagen, Denmark from 1991-1994.  During Simon's second year abroad, he was named to the Denmark All-Star Team.  

Simon was also part of the Roskilde BBK team that was promoted into the Elite-division during his second year as a player-coach.  

After returning to Canada and obtaining a B.A. from UBC, Simon coached the Jr. and Sr. Boys teams at Kitsilano Secondary to provincial titles in 2000, 2001 and 2002. From there, Simon went on to earn himself the job as Head Coach of the Langara Falcons from 2002-2004.
